The theses present a scientific justification of the methods of administrative and legal provision of citizens' rights and freedoms in the sphere of state administration under martial law from the standpoint of administrative and legal science and public administration. The relevance of considering the rights and freedoms of a citizen as an independent object of state administration, the implementation of which in a special period is significantly influenced by security factors and requires the adaptation of administrative and legal instruments, is substantiated. The main doctrinal approaches to understanding citizens' rights in relation to the functions of public authority are revealed, which made it possible to determine the administrative and legal nature of the mechanisms for their provision. The constitutional and legal and administrative and legal principles of the introduction of martial law are analyzed, the features of the normative regulation of temporary restrictions on citizens' rights and freedoms are clarified, and the legal boundaries of such restrictions are determined in accordance with the principles of the rule of law and proportionality. Considerable attention is paid to the analysis of special legislation and subordinate normative legal acts regulating the activities of public authorities under martial law, as well as to the assessment of their impact on the practical implementation of citizens' rights. The institutional mechanisms of public administration in the field of ensuring the rights and freedoms of citizens during a special period are characterized, in particular, the system of executive authorities, local self-government bodies and law enforcement agencies, their powers and features of interaction.The role of administrative and legal instruments and procedures, administrative decisions and special legal regimes applied under martial law is analyzed, and the main problems and risks of violation of citizens' rights associated with the expansion of discretionary powers and the reduction of procedural guarantees are identified. Based on the generalization of the research results, directions for optimizing public administration mechanisms in ensuring the rights and freedoms of citizens were substantiated, which include improving administrative and legal regulation, strengthening the institutional capacity of public authorities, developing control and accountability mechanisms, as well as integrating international and European standards of citizens' rights.
